When blood glucose levels rise above the normal range, the pancreas secretes ________, but when blood glucose levels fall below
the normal range, the pancreas secretes ________. a.insulin; glucagon b.epinephrine; glucagon c.glucagon; insulin d.epinephrine; insulin e.glucagon; glycogen
1 answer:
Glucose level increase, insulin is secreted.
glucose level decrease, glucagon is secreted
